TPWallet深度评测:安全、分布式存储与链下计算的数字化路线图

以下内容为对 TPWallet 的结构化分析与概念性拆解(不代表对任何特定实现的绝对安全背书)。由于不同版本、链与部署方式可能存在差异,建议你在正式使用前以项目的官方文档、审计报告与链上证据为准。

一、安全测试(Security Testing)

1)代码与合约层面的测试体系

- 单元测试:覆盖关键函数(如转账、授权、路由、签名校验、费率计算、权限管理),重点关注边界条件与异常分支。

- 集成测试:模拟多链、多合约交互,验证资产跨合约流转、消息传递与回滚机制。

- 模糊测试(Fuzzing):对输入参数进行随机与变异,以捕获溢出、类型截断、异常编码、非预期状态切换等问题。

- 静态/动态分析:静态扫描识别已知漏洞模式;动态分析(含运行时监控)用于检测权限绕过、错误的签名校验与重入触发点。

2)合约审计与威胁建模

- 权限与升级机制:检查是否存在过度权限(如管理员可任意转移资金)、升级合约的治理门槛是否充分、Timelock 是否存在、紧急暂停是否可滥用。

- 授权/许可风险:重点核查“无限授权”、Permit/签名授权流程、以及撤销授权的可用性。

- 重入与跨链调用:若涉及桥/路由/聚合,需分析外部调用顺序、回调逻辑、以及链间消息确认与重放攻击防护。

- 经济模型与可利用性:不仅看漏洞是否存在,还要评估是否“可被利用”、利用成本、以及可造成的最大损失。

3)钱包级别安全(比合约更关键)

- 私钥与助记词管理:是否支持本地加密、冷热分离、是否有泄露面(日志、剪贴板、浏览器存储、调试开关)。

- 签名交互与交易确认:交易可视化是否清晰(合约地址、金额、gas、权限变化),防止“签名钓鱼”。

- 防止恶意 DApp 注入:检查会不会被第三方页面诱导更换路由或参数。

- 漏洞响应:应关注是否存在持续补丁节奏、公告透明度、以及 bug bounty/安全团队机制。

二、分布式存储技术(Distributed Storage)

在去中心化或多链生态中,“分布式存储”通常对应两类需求:

- 存储链上可引用的数据(如索引、元数据、验证材料)

- 存储链下内容并通过哈希/承诺连接到链上(如交易证明、日志、配置、索引结果)

1)可能的技术路线

- 内容寻址(如按哈希定位):通过内容哈希将数据与链上状态绑定,降低篡改风险。

- 冗余与纠删编码:提升可用性与抗丢失能力。

- 网络化存储节点:通过激励或治理机制保证数据可检索。

2)与钱包体验的关系

- 快速加载:分布式存储能显著降低“读取中断”,尤其是跨链资产、NFT 元数据、或交易历史索引。

- 抗审查与可持续访问:在中心化网关失效时仍能提供内容。

- 成本权衡:存储越分布式,读取链路、带宽与延迟控制越关键;需要缓存策略与容错设计。

3)安全要点

- 完整性校验:读取内容后用链上哈希或签名验证,避免“同名不同内容”。

- 访问权限与隐私:如果存储包含用户敏感信息,应采用端到端加密或最小化明文。

- 节点可信假设:需要明确“节点是否诚实”的边界,以及失败重试/降级策略。

三、前瞻性数字革命(Forward-looking Digital Revolution)

“前瞻性数字革命”可从钱包/聚合器对行业的推动方向来理解:

- 从“单链转账”走向“账户抽象与多链统一体验”:让用户以更直观方式管理资产与授权。

- 从“纯资产管理”走向“智能路由与交易意图”:减少用户参数理解成本。

- 从“静态应用”走向“动态协作”:钱包与交易聚合、身份系统、凭证体系之间形成更紧密的协同。

若 TPWallet 在产品层面强调更顺滑的跨链交互、清晰的风险提示、以及更低的操作摩擦,那么它在“数字革命”的叙事上就更贴近真实需求:让 Web3 更像基础互联网工具,而不是只有熟练者才能使用的实验品。

四、高科技商业模式(High-tech Business Model)

高科技商业模式通常看三件事:收入来源、技术壁垒、以及增长方式。

1)可能的收入来源

- 交易聚合与路由服务费(来自交换/跨链/挖矿路由等环节)

- 手续费分成(与 DEX、桥、Gas 供应或服务商合作)

- 增值服务:企业级钱包、托管/安全服务、API/SDK

- 生态激励:流动性/用户增长计划与生态补贴

2)技术壁垒

- 更优的路径选择:在多 DEX、多流动性池、多链之间动态定价与路由。

- 更可靠的风险控制:通过额度校验、交易模拟、合约元数据解析等降低失败率。

- 更强的用户资产体验:统一资产视图、多链余额与活动记录可追溯。

3)合规与可持续

- 合规策略与地域限制:取决于其业务是否涉及法币入口、托管服务或特定服务。

- 透明度:对费率、结算、合作方披露程度决定用户信任。

五、合约兼容(Contract Compatibility)

合约兼容关注的不只是“能不能调用”,而是“调用的语义是否一致、风险提示是否准确”。

1)EVM 兼容与标准接口

- ERC-20/721/1155 标准:确保代币余额、转账事件、元数据读取与授权流程符合预期。

- 代理合约/路由合约:合约调用参数、代理上下文与事件映射需要正确。

2)聚合与路由兼容

- 多协议聚合:不同 DEX/路由协议的交换参数差异较大,兼容性体现在参数转换、滑点控制与失败回退。

- 交易模拟:合约兼容不仅是“能发交易”,还要“先模拟再确认”。

3)版本与安全的兼容

- 处理不同版本合约的事件字段变化、反常返回值(如某些旧代币不返回 bool)。

- 对潜在恶意代币(转账扣费、回调触发)提供更明确的提示或限制。

六、链下计算(Off-chain Computation)

链下计算常见目的:降低链上成本、提升速度、增强用户体验。但其“正确性与可验证性”必须设计好。

1)链下计算通常做什么

- 路由与报价聚合:在多源流动性中做路由搜索与最优路径估计。

- 交易模拟与风险评估:推断成功概率、估算 gas、检测明显的权限/参数风险。

- 索引与历史解析:交易历史、余额变动、活动聚合等。

2)关键挑战:可信与可验证

- 结果可验证:若链下决定最终路由,最好能通过链上校验(如最终交易仍由链上执行并可回溯),或提供可验证的证据(如哈希承诺、证明机制)。

- 降低中心化算力风险:链下服务节点故障或被操控可能影响报价与路径;需要多源校验、容错与回退。

- 防篡改:链下返回若影响交易参数,应确保参数来源可靠,并在签名前对关键字段做一致性校验。

3)与用户体验的平衡

- 即时性:链下计算提升响应速度。

- 安全性:必须在签名前完成足够的校验与可视化解释。

- 透明度:让用户知道哪些由链下生成,哪些由链上最终裁决。

结论

总体而言,从“安全测试—分布式存储—链下计算—合约兼容—商业模式—前瞻数字革命”的逻辑框架看,一个优秀的 TPWallet(或同类多链钱包)应做到:

- 安全上:不仅做合约审计,更要覆盖钱包签名与权限交互;并保持持续响应。

- 技术上:分布式存储提升可用性与抗审查,同时通过哈希/校验绑定链上可信。

- 体验上:链下计算负责速度,但必须在签名前提供足够的校验与可视化风险信息。

- 生态上:合约兼容与协议适配要稳定,减少“能不能用”的不确定性。

如果你愿意,我也可以按你的使用场景(例如:只做交换/跨链、还是主要管理资产/NFT、是否涉及 DApp 登录与授权)把上述维度做成“核对清单”,帮助你更快判断 TPWallet 在你关心的风险点上是否满足预期。

作者:林澈发布时间:2026-06-15 06:43:16

评论

LunaWen

整体框架写得很清楚,尤其链下计算那段:既要快也要可验证,缺一不可。

阿森1994

安全测试讲到权限/重入/授权钓鱼,感觉比只谈合约漏洞更贴近真实使用。

ZhiYun

分布式存储与哈希绑定的思路很关键,希望后面能给出更具体的实现例子。

NovaLin

合约兼容部分提到交易模拟和事件映射差异,这点很实用。

小雾花

商业模式和技术壁垒联系起来了,但也想看看费率透明度与合规策略怎么写。

相关阅读